Type
ORACLE
Validation date
2023-05-24 23:37:00 UTC
Fee
0 UCO

Code (249 B)

condition inherit: [
  # We need to ensure the type stays consistent
  # So we can apply specific rules during the transaction validation
  type: in?([oracle, oracle_summary]),

  # We discard the content and code verification
  content: true,

  # We ensure the code stay the same
  code: if type == oracle_summary do
    regex_match?("condition inherit: \\[[\\s].*content: \\\"\\\"[\\s].*]")
  else
    previous.code
  end
]

Content (37 B)

{
  "uco": {
    "eur": 0.05892,
    "usd": 0.06336
  }
}

State (0 B)

Movements (0)

Ownerships (0)

Contract recipients (0)

Inputs (0)

Contract inputs (0)

Unspent outputs (1)

Proofs and signatures

Previous public key

0001B8BC0F78CE579113F382F3DE18A893D479912CA92E582BDEA166C880AFA8C647

Previous signature

FA29975C16C384A99413CB52886D58747448A9659067B0FDC004862B0E6703DE0B6F3CA38E727D82E5D1A56DFF43E19330EB810A91F0BDBE11EB16B1E26BA801

Origin signature

3045022057AD35D2BBDAF8E711CBA25D0955323D6198DFEE39113ED90FD10548E1DBB65F022100D8FFB669A35D03C7FA129E1117F8695DA62A6E827922D3193BC328FDE5E20295

Proof of work

010104B24203AF814C80F7128B8E8B5A6BADE625B0A52FFBA1BAA579D7471F05549929F8DCF5277BF2162CD798725D27AEAEBEB6B473C8D94376015A479F0FE263A426

Proof of integrity

0075BEFB5A39EA24F4161ACD82AE599991F7122936ECE8ED358833670C24477472

Coordinator signature

CBBFFC1FE58ECEDE05BDC7232AA7FEAEAE99BA406F998422BD0954F4161BE6D1148AAB292DCF72F497921E026C1A33A0C544C9950A800C5275E108DF588E050D

Validator #1 public key

0001500FBE298B79FFBDD5CCA1798F30FD88A53D26EC39DE5DDE1F4137B032A4BC34

Validator #1 signature

1F3FC4BBB70A946F6E745BD398DA708E8E420E41630BB3D324C53668A9C610C547C8F44FF2B844E0CB98EF5B30AC6EFA03FAABBD993991D969C3ABCE0DE0A703

Validator #2 public key

0001A1DC9238343CE9F82C9EB5BEE0AC5121FDA6E2E71B3AA94E87FB5D789B7D7E3C

Validator #2 signature

25E9CEDDC8E9CB8F59CE5DA3BF50F28609DF9F146B65B9F3194580DE0B57901D721E3AEE696F83077D35229C1B3DB7109EBA34EAF93B9D495E9D8EE8B9FD470F